Question of the day

The line of pull in a static progressive orthosis with an outrigger should be at what degree to avoid shearing?

Explanation:
To gain controlled ROM with a static progressive orthosis and an outrigger, the force should create a pure bending moment about the joint while minimizing shear on the soft tissues and joint surfaces. Positioning the line of pull roughly perpendicular to the segment (about ninety degrees) maximizes the rotational moment about the joint, making extension or flexion gains more efficient and reducing shear forces. If the pull is more aligned with the bone (closer to zero degrees) or at odd angles, more of the force translates into shear or translation at the joint, which can irritate tissues and be less effective for ROM. Angles like sixty or one hundred thirty-five degrees mix torque with shear and are not as ideal. Therefore, aim for a line of pull at about ninety degrees.

Understanding the Exam Format

The Occupational Therapy Methods 2 Exam is meticulously designed to evaluate a candidate's understanding of core principles and application of various therapy methods. This examination consists primarily of multiple-choice questions, a format that allows for the comprehensive assessment of a candidate’s knowledge.

  • Question Structure: The exam includes multiple-choice questions with four possible answers each, testing theoretical knowledge and practical application alike.
  • Number of Questions: Candidates are presented with a total of 80 questions.
  • Duration: The exam is timed, requiring completion within 120 minutes. Proper time management during the exam is crucial.
  • Passing Score: To advance in their occupational therapy education, candidates must achieve a minimum score of 70%.
